Asa Medical Office Administrator you will be responsible for managingthe daily operations of a healthcare facility ensuring efficientadministrative processes while providing excellent service topatients and staff.

Your role will be essential in maintaining thesmooth functioning of the office and supporting healthcareproviders.

KeyResponsibilities :

  • Overseethe administrative functions of the medical office includingscheduling patient registration and medical recordmanagement.
  • Ensurecompliance with healthcare regulations and standards maintainingconfidentiality and security of patientinformation.
  • Coordinatepatient appointments managing the scheduling system to optimizeworkflow and minimize waittimes.
  • Serveas the primary point of contact for patients addressing inquiriesand concerns while providing exceptional customerservice.
  • Managebilling and insurance processes including verifying patientinsurance coverage and processingclaims.
  • Superviseadministrative staff providing training support and performanceevaluations to foster a productive workenvironment.
  • Collaboratewith healthcare providers to ensure effective communication andcoordination of patientcare.
  • Maintainoffice supplies and equipment managing inventory and vendorrelationships asneeded

Requirements

  • Associates degree in Health Administration Business Administration or arelated field; Bachelor s degreepreferred.
  • Previousexperience in a medical office or healthcare setting with at leasttwo years in an administrativerole.
  • Strongknowledge of medical terminology billing procedures and healthcareregulations.
  • Excellentorganizational and multitasking skills with attention todetail.
  • Proficientin electronic health record (EHR) systems and officesoftware.
  • Strongcommunication and interpersonal skills with a commitment toproviding compassionate patientcare.
